What Is REI? Is It a Real Company?

Yes, REI is real. REI (Recreational Equipment, Inc.) was founded in 1938 by Lloyd and Mary Anderson in Seattle, Washington as a consumer cooperative. The company is structured as a co-op — owned by its 23+ million members — rather than as a publicly traded corporation.

So if you're asking 'is REI a real company?' — yes, and it's been a real company for 87 years. REI operates 175 stores across 41 U.S. states, employs over 16,000 people, and generates annual revenue exceeding $3.5 billion. The company specializes in outdoor recreation gear and apparel for hiking, camping, climbing, cycling, water sports, fitness, snow sports, and adventure travel.
